RS Sailing Adds New Daysailer to their Adventure Range: Introducing the RS Aira 22

RS Sailing are proud to announce the addition of the RS Aira 22 to their cruising portfolio, as they take on the build license, distribution, marketing and sales from Aira Boats. This keelboat represents a significant step forward in RS Sailing's strategy to make sailing more accessible to a wider audience, blending comfort, innovation, and performance in a unique, all-inclusive package.

"As we continue to grow our presence in the leisure sailing market, the RS Aira 22 embodies our commitment to expanding the sport of sailing beyond competitive racing and into the realm of family-friendly adventure," explains RS Sailing's Commercial Director, Michiel Geerling. For the past ten years, RS Sailing has steadily grown their offerings for leisure sailors and rental companies with boats like the RS Zest, RS Quest, RS Toura, and RS Venture, addressing the diverse needs of recreational sailors. Michiel adds: "As market interest in daysailing grew, we recognised a need to add a larger vessel to our line-up - a flagship keelboat that merges comfort, performance and accessibility. Enter the RS Aira 22!"

The RS Aira 22 draws inspiration from the daysailer tradition in the Netherlands, where families frequently enjoy time on the water in boats that are both practical and comfortable. "It is a nice balance of sport and leisure, and, of course, we will be adding our own RS stamp on the product."

Welcoming the RS Aira 22 into The RS Adventure Range

The original Aira 22 was born in 2018, developed by Jos Snijders Blok, founder of Aira Boats. The boat was designed for recreational sailors and gained popularity with sailing schools and rental centres in the Netherlands. As Jos prepared for retirement, he approached the RS Sailing team, to bring the Aira 22 into the RS Family and onto the world stage.

Michiel commented: "We'd been in talks with Jos for several years, and the Aira 22 has always stood out as a smart and innovative boat. We're thrilled to now be able to expand its reach and introduce it to a global audience. The RS Aira 22 is truly the future of accessible and enjoyable sailing. We will ensure that Jos' legacy lives on while sharing this exceptional product with day sailors worldwide."

RS Aira 22 Features & Performance

Whether adventuring or racing, the RS Aira 22 allows families and friends to disconnect from the pressures of the everyday and reconnect with nature. The daysailer is designed with ergonomics and safety in mind, offering a spacious cockpit, higher boom, ample storage space, and comfortable seating options, complete with cushions. The boat also features a foldable table and a retractable built-in e-propulsion electric engine, making it the perfect choice for sailors who wish to spend time on the water without the pressure of a rigid itinerary.

But what about the performance? "We often describe the Aira as a comfort-focused boat with the sleek lines of a modern sportsboat," explains Jos. Its design features contribute to its performance capabilities. Attributes include a wide beam, a flat bottom, a wide stern, and a powerful square-top mainsail, which is a modern feature for open keelboats in this size range. Jos adds: "Many customers report, after some time sailing, that the boat performs faster than they initially expected. They've participated in club races, often outpacing other open keelboats and smaller cabin yachts." Whether for family outings or for rental fleets, the RS Aira 22's sailing qualities exceed expectations, promising to redefine the day-sailing experience.

Versatility for Recreational Sailors and Hire Centres

"There is a real need to engage more people in sailing, especially families," explains Michiel. "We want to ensure that sailing remains an enjoyable, accessible activity. The RS Aira 22 is something for the whole family and I can also see it being a big hit with hire centres and sailing schools around the globe. Its versatility means that one day it is a daysailer and the next day it could be a club racer. The hull design ensures effortless planing, while the 28m² gennaker elevates the boat into a powerhouse of fun! It strikes the ideal balance between comfort and performance."

The introduction of the RS Aira 22 marks an exciting milestone in RS Sailing's ongoing efforts to make sailing a more inclusive, enjoyable, and sustainable sport for people of all ages and backgrounds. The RS Sailing Store will also be supplying parts and spares for both new and existing customers who have purchased from Aira Boats in the past.
